[QUOTE="beer_stud_76, post: 507343, member: 34459"] i realize this is an old thread but i must jump to the defense of loud pipes. of course everyone's definition of "loud" is different, and 96db will still be too loud for some. however, here in western Wa, you don't see a dirtbike comming the other way on a trail from way off. in fact 99% of the time you don't seem them till you have met at a blind corner. in addition to my fairly loud XR600 i ride my mountain bike on these trails and my old lady rides horses in areas often used bike dirtbikes. both of us actually LIKE the loud bikes. we hear them and can get out of the way. i can't tell you how many times i've been early pasted head long by one of you "considerate" quiet dirtbikers, but i can say that i've never had a close call with a loud bike. its a legitimate safety issue. loud bikes save lives. period. there can be no counter argument to this. maybe in the wide open desert where you can see a dust cloud or something from a long way off this is a moot point. and i can see how an MX track packed with extra loud bikes might be a nuisaunce(sp) to the nieghbors. but out here in the dense muddy woods what sound there is doesn't travel far. as far as i'm concerned, i'd rather ride a quiet bike. but me and my bike wiegh a combined 600lbs or so. this going down a trail even at a modest pace is enough to kill a man or break a horses' leg or whatever. so far, and often because of my loudish bike, i haven't had a single scary moment with another trail user. jeremiah [/QUOTE]
